Richmond volleyball star Anna Keefe believes confidence pushed her side to School Games victory
Richmond volleyball star Anna Keefe believes it was teamwork that won the day as she captained her side to glory
Richmond volleyball star Anna Keefe believes it was teamwork that won the day as she captained her side to glory